Overview

Zhimin Jian is affiliated with Tongji University in China. Their research activity spans the fields of Earth and Planetary Sciences and Environmental Science, with a focus on several subfields including Atmospheric Science, Ecology, Environmental Chemistry, Oceanography, and Geology.

Their main research topics cover a variety of areas such as:

  • Geology and Paleoclimatology Research
  • Methane Hydrates and Related Phenomena
  • Isotope Analysis in Ecology
  • Geological and Geophysical Studies
  • Marine and coastal ecosystems
  • Geological formations and processes
  • Climate variability and models
